Verify on SAM.govfor Information – C&T Innovation Day White Paper Submission DLA is soliciting white papers for Clothing & Textiles (C&T) innovations in fabrics, materials, components, manufacturing processes and end item in advance of the C&T Innovation Day to be held on August 20, 2026 at the Baroni Center for Government Contracting, George Mason University. The
objective is to provide DoW an opportunity to review emerging domestic industrial base technologies for potential adoption into future
requirements. Scope of white papers should cover at least one of the following: Propose new capabilities Incorporate new technology into existing end items Identify areas where existing commercial solutions could alleviate ongoing supply chain bottlenecks Propose potential cost-saving solutions Identify cross‑Service commonality opportunities for cost savings and scalability Provide mitigation to current supply‑chain risks White paper submission information: White paper submissions are due by July 20, 2026. Firms can submit separate white papers on different innovations. Each white paper shall not exceed 2 written pages, single spaced at a 12pt font. Information beyond 2 pages will not be reviewed. White papers are to be submitted to [email protected] DLA will review all submissions and notify firms if DLA and the Services are interested in learning additional information about your submission as part of the August 20, 2026 event. The government will limit attendance at individual submission presentations to safeguard industry competitive advantages.
